Internet Showcase Stars
Industry conference yields several intriguing Web product previews.

By Don Willmott
PC Magazine
January 29, 1998

The day's most entertaining demonstration had to be that of WavePhore (WAVO), whose WaveTop is a service broadcasting 140MB of rich content every day over PBS's close-captioning wavelength. If you have a TV tuner installed in your PC, you can go to the WaveTop site and see colorful, entertaining content in a variety of categories, and it all downloads very quickly. Installing software from the Web becomes almost instantaneous, and you can load and play a game within seconds. The client software and the service are free; they're advertising-supported. The client will be built into Windows 98.--Don Willmott

With 80 percent of the Internet's content in English, language translation is definitely a growth market. Lernout & Hauspie (LHSPF) showed Internet Translation, which lets you search the Web in your native language and receive site summaries in your language, no matter what language the site uses. You can even see versions of the same Web page in two languages, side by side. Pricing for the service, which is due to start in June, hasn't been determined.
